We are members of XR looking at why, when people come together to bring about change, too often we end up fighting each other rather than working together.
For example, how do we address oppression (such as classism, sexism, racism, etc.) in ways that don't create further division? How do we rebuild relationships and trust that have been broken?
The workshop includes space for personal sharing and experience of practical tools.
